The MCP4811-E/P belongs to the category of digital-to-analog converters (DACs).
It is primarily used for converting digital signals into analog voltage outputs.
The MCP4811-E/P is available in an 8-pin plastic dual inline package (PDIP). It is typically sold in quantities of one unit per package.

What is the MCP4811-E/P?
The MCP4811-E/P is a single-channel, 8-bit digital-to-analog converter (DAC) that can be used in various technical solutions.
What is the supply voltage range for the MCP4811-E/P?
The supply voltage range for the MCP4811-E/P is 2.7V to 5.5V.
What is the output voltage range of the MCP4811-E/P?
The output voltage range of the MCP4811-E/P is 0V to Vref.
Can the MCP4811-E/P be used in industrial control applications?
Yes, the MCP4811-E/P is suitable for use in industrial control applications due to its reliability and performance.
Is the MCP4811-E/P compatible with SPI communication?
Yes, the MCP4811-E/P supports Serial Peripheral Interface (SPI) communication for easy integration into digital systems.
What is the typical settling time for the MCP4811-E/P?
The typical settling time for the MCP4811-E/P is 4.5µs.
Can the MCP4811-E/P be used in battery-powered devices?
Yes, the low power consumption of the MCP4811-E/P makes it suitable for use in battery-powered devices.
